Output ecfd79b2f463358765318d05c94b9ba6fca0e5f5385a17160f09f151da458045:3

value
39208623
script pubkey
OP_0 OP_PUSHBYTES_32 ea361235bd4085a70b44be8ef9b31170e00004c920fcfefce97ceaba5ce6cdd0
address
bc1qagmpyddagzz6wz6yh680nvc3wrsqqpxfyr70al8f0n4t5h8xehgqeafrkt
transaction
ecfd79b2f463358765318d05c94b9ba6fca0e5f5385a17160f09f151da458045
spent
true